当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

分布式存储是对象存储吗,分布式存储与对象存储的关系探讨,是同质还是互补?

分布式存储是对象存储吗,分布式存储与对象存储的关系探讨,是同质还是互补?

分布式存储与对象存储存在密切关系,两者并非同质,而是互补,分布式存储通过分散节点实现海量数据存储,而对象存储以对象为单位管理数据,两者结合可优化存储效率和灵活性。...

分布式存储与对象存储存在密切关系,两者并非同质,而是互补,分布式存储通过分散节点实现海量数据存储,而对象存储以对象为单位管理数据,两者结合可优化存储效率和灵活性。

随着互联网技术的飞速发展,数据量呈爆炸式增长,传统的存储方式已无法满足海量数据的存储需求,分布式存储作为一种新型存储技术,逐渐成为行业热点,关于分布式存储与对象存储的关系,业界存在诸多争议,本文将从分布式存储与对象存储的定义、特点、应用场景等方面进行探讨,旨在揭示两者之间的联系与区别。

分布式存储与对象存储的定义

分布式存储

分布式存储是一种将数据分散存储在多个物理节点上的存储方式,通过分布式存储,可以实现数据的高可用性、高可靠性和高性能,分布式存储系统通常采用分布式文件系统、分布式数据库等技术,如Hadoop、Cassandra、Zookeeper等。

分布式存储是对象存储吗,分布式存储与对象存储的关系探讨,是同质还是互补?

图片来源于网络,如有侵权联系删除

对象存储

对象存储是一种以对象为单位存储数据的存储方式,对象存储系统将数据分为对象、元数据和存储路径三个部分,对象可以是文件、图片、视频等,对象存储系统具有高扩展性、高可靠性、高可用性等特点,如Amazon S3、Google Cloud Storage、阿里云OSS等。

分布式存储与对象存储的特点

分布式存储特点

(1)高可用性:分布式存储通过数据冗余、故障转移等技术,确保数据在多个节点上存储,即使某个节点发生故障,也能保证数据不丢失。

(2)高可靠性:分布式存储采用数据复制、备份等技术,确保数据在多个节点上备份,提高数据可靠性。

(3)高性能:分布式存储通过数据分散存储在多个节点上,可以实现并行读写,提高系统性能。

(4)高扩展性:分布式存储系统可以根据需求动态增加节点,实现横向扩展。

对象存储特点

(1)高可用性:对象存储系统采用数据冗余、故障转移等技术,确保数据不丢失。

(2)高可靠性:对象存储系统采用数据备份、存储节点冗余等技术,提高数据可靠性。

(3)高扩展性:对象存储系统可以通过增加存储节点来实现横向扩展。

(4)简单易用:对象存储系统采用HTTP协议,用户可以通过Web界面或API进行数据访问,操作简单。

分布式存储与对象存储的应用场景

分布式存储应用场景

分布式存储是对象存储吗,分布式存储与对象存储的关系探讨,是同质还是互补?

图片来源于网络,如有侵权联系删除

(1)大数据处理:分布式存储系统可以存储海量数据,适用于大数据处理场景。

(2)云计算:分布式存储系统可以提供高可用性、高可靠性的存储服务,适用于云计算平台。

(3)高性能计算:分布式存储系统可以实现数据并行读写,适用于高性能计算场景。

对象存储应用场景

(1)云存储:对象存储系统具有高可用性、高可靠性,适用于云存储场景。

(2)大数据分析:对象存储系统可以存储海量数据,适用于大数据分析场景。

(3)多媒体内容分发:对象存储系统可以存储大量图片、视频等媒体内容,适用于多媒体内容分发场景。

分布式存储与对象存储的关系

互补关系

分布式存储与对象存储在技术特点和应用场景上存在互补关系,分布式存储侧重于数据的高可用性、高可靠性和高性能,而对象存储侧重于数据的高扩展性和简单易用,在实际应用中,两者可以相互结合,发挥各自优势。

独立关系

虽然分布式存储与对象存储在技术特点和应用场景上存在互补关系,但两者在本质上仍属于不同的存储技术,分布式存储是一种存储架构,而对象存储是一种存储系统,在实际应用中,可以根据需求选择合适的存储技术。

分布式存储与对象存储在技术特点和应用场景上存在互补关系,但两者在本质上仍属于不同的存储技术,在实际应用中,可以根据需求选择合适的存储技术,或将两者相结合,发挥各自优势,随着技术的不断发展,分布式存储与对象存储将在未来存储领域发挥越来越重要的作用。

黑狐家游戏

发表评论

最新文章